Gr 5-7-Cassidy Silver thinks that surviving seventh grade may require special powers. Her best friend has abandoned her for the popular girls, whose mean-spirited teasing is relentless. Her teacher Mr. McMaran is not only boring, but he's also disgruntled. And her little brother, who is also teased at school, needs Cassidy to look out for him. But the 12-year-old doesn't have special powers, and she feels that she can't bother her mom with problems. Her dad is on an extended engineering job in the Middle East, and her mother is keeping so busy volunteering and painting that she doesn't seem to have time for anything else. Then a new girl, Victoria, appears on the scene, and she claims to be telekinetic. Does she really have a special power? Can Cassidy learn telekinesis too? The answers may surprise readers. The compassionate protagonist approaches her troubles with patience and good humor, and she is a good friend to Victoria, who is facing her own family difficulties (including an older half brother who steals). The theme here is how to deal with bullying-by peers, teachers, and family members. Realistic fiction with a twist, "Impossible Things" should appeal to thoughtful readers, who may gain insight into standing up to their own bulliesno supernatural powers required."Laurie Slagenwhite, Baldwin Public Library, Birmingham, MI"
Copyright 2008 School Library Journal, LLC Used with permission.

Quirky outcast Cassidy Silver feels friendless in seventh grade after being dumped by her best friend. But then Victoria, who doesnt like to talk about her past, moves to town and befriends Cassidy, who is intrigued and fascinated by Victorias claim that she has telekinetic powers. Cassidy believes that if she can learn telekinesis, too, she could get back at the bully who has been harassing her little brother, also a quirky outcast. But is Victoria lying about her telekinetic abilities, and about other things, too? As Cassidy sorts out how she feels about her new friend, she slowly but surely grows more secure in herself and develops a solid group of friends among the other outcasts of her class. There are too many plotlines, muddying the overall impact of the story, but the paranormal powers that Victoria claims provide an alluring twist to the unreliable new friend trope.(Reprinted with permission of Booklist, copyright 2008, American Library Association.)
